Capturar dados de WebService
Bom Dia,
Não estou conseguindo capturar dados de um array de objetos, os outros eu consigo pegar normalmente mas o campo que traz um array eu não estou conseguindo. Por exemplo o campo histórico de Nome.
Vcs podem me ajudar por favor
Estrutura do webservice:
Campo Tipo Descrição
nomeCivil String Nome civil do aluno.
vetHistNomeCivil Vetor<DadosHistNome> Histórico de alterações do nome civil
..................
Classe DadosHistNome
nomeAnterior String Nome anterior do aluno
tsMudancaNome String Timestamp de mudança do nome
Código PHP
$result = $response->obterDadosAlunoSGDResult->resultado;
if($result){
if(isset($response->obterDadosAlunoDDDResult->nomeCivil)){
$arrayInfo['nomeCivil'] = $response->obterDadosAlunoDDDResult->nomeCivil;
}
if(isset($response->obterDadosAlunoDDDResult->vetHistNomeCivil)){
$arrayInfo['vetHistNomeCivil'] = $response->obterDadosAlunoDDDResult->vetHistNomeCivil;
}
Não estou conseguindo capturar dados de um array de objetos, os outros eu consigo pegar normalmente mas o campo que traz um array eu não estou conseguindo. Por exemplo o campo histórico de Nome.
Vcs podem me ajudar por favor
Estrutura do webservice:
Campo Tipo Descrição
nomeCivil String Nome civil do aluno.
vetHistNomeCivil Vetor<DadosHistNome> Histórico de alterações do nome civil
..................
Classe DadosHistNome
nomeAnterior String Nome anterior do aluno
tsMudancaNome String Timestamp de mudança do nome
Código PHP
$result = $response->obterDadosAlunoSGDResult->resultado;
if($result){
if(isset($response->obterDadosAlunoDDDResult->nomeCivil)){
$arrayInfo['nomeCivil'] = $response->obterDadosAlunoDDDResult->nomeCivil;
}
if(isset($response->obterDadosAlunoDDDResult->vetHistNomeCivil)){
$arrayInfo['vetHistNomeCivil'] = $response->obterDadosAlunoDDDResult->vetHistNomeCivil;
}
Anderson Cruz
Curtidas 0
Respostas
Anderson Cruz
03/05/2016
Alguém?
GOSTEI 0